Hanna Kyselova, artist Born at 1976 in Kiev, Ukraine Activities: easel and monumental sculpture, ceramics, fountains, graphics, street art, pedagogy Creations are in the Museum of Modern Art of Ukraine, in the Terra Center for Fine and Applied Arts, in the Changchun International Ceramics Gallery , in public space of Ukraine (Kiev), Turkey (Izmir), Canada ( Sent-George), Serbia ( Kikinda) and in private collections. Works in public spaces: * A monument of grasshopper * ( Kiev, NAOMA Park) – 2000 *Сhildren against the mashine * ( Kiev, Pechersk ) - 2011 "Grandma Classics" ( Kyiv, Shevchenko Park) – 2011 "Grandma with duck" ( Kyiv, Rusanivska Embankment ) – 2013 "Pissing girl” (Turkey, İzmir ) – 2016 “Ebbs and flows” ( Serbia, Kikinda ) – 2018 * Sacrament* ( Moldova , Ivanche ) – 2018 *Barefoot on the planet* ( Canada, Sent – George) – 2019
